Quick Buyer’s Guide: How to Choose

Before comparing specific models, answer these three questions to narrow your search fast:

  • What thickness do you cut most often? If you rarely go past 1/4″, a 30A to 50A unit is plenty. For regular 1/2″ to 3/4″ work, look at 60A models. This avoids overspending on capacity you will not use.
  • What power do you have? A standard 120V/15A household outlet limits you to about 20-30A of cutting output. If you have or can add a 240V circuit, you unlock the full power of dual-voltage machines.
  • Handheld or CNC? Most cutters here work great by hand. If you plan to add a CNC plasma table later, choose a blowback/non-HF model (like the PrimeWeld CUT60 or YESWELDER CUT-60DS PRO) so the arc start does not interfere with electronics.

FAQ

Which Plasma Cutter Should I Choose for a Home Shop?

Pick a machine that matches the thickness and type of metal you cut most often.

If you cut mostly sheet metal and occasional 1/4″ plate, a compact dual-voltage unit with a good pilot arc and reliable torch gives you the best mix of portability and performance. Look for dual voltage if you want to run from 120V outlets, 240V circuits, or a generator. Check the duty cycle if you plan longer sessions. Prefer brands with accessible consumables and customer support so you can keep working with minimal downtime.

What Power and Air Setup Do I Need?

Confirm whether the cutter is 110/120V, 220/240V, or dual voltage and make sure your shop circuit can supply the required amperage. Smaller units run fine on standard shop outlets, while higher-amp cutters need a 240V circuit.

For compressed air, aim for clean, dry air at the pressure and flow the manufacturer specifies. Use a regulator, filter, and moisture trap to protect consumables and improve cut quality.

A typical hobby setup works at moderate pressures with a small compressor for light cutting. Heavier or continuous cutting needs higher flow and a sturdier compressor. Most manufacturers recommend at least 4-5 CFM at 60-80 PSI.

How Do I Maintain Consumables and Reduce Long-Term Costs?

Keep spare nozzles and electrodes that match your model so you do not stop mid-project. Follow the recommended air pressure and amperage to avoid premature wear.

Clean the torch and leads after use. Avoid dragging the nozzle on the workpiece. Replace consumables at the first sign of degraded cut quality to prevent damage to the torch.

Choose a machine with easy-to-find parts and decent manufacturer support. Check consumable availability before you commit, and stock spares for anything you use regularly.

What Is the Difference Between Pilot Arc, Blowback Start, and High-Frequency Start?

Pilot arc / blowback start: The torch generates a small arc inside the nozzle before you bring it near the metal. You do not need to touch the tip to the workpiece. This protects consumables, works on rusty or painted surfaces, and does not interfere with nearby electronics. Most cutters in this roundup use this method.

High-frequency (HF) start: The machine sends a high-voltage, high-frequency pulse to jump the gap and initiate the arc. This also works without touching the metal, but the HF signal can interfere with CNC controllers, computers, and other sensitive electronics nearby. The hynade PLC-50D in this list uses HF start, so it is best for handheld use only.

If you plan to use a CNC plasma table, choose a blowback or non-HF pilot arc unit.

What Size Compressor Do I Need for Plasma Cutting?

For most 50A cutters on this list, a compressor delivering at least 3.5–4 CFM at 60–70 PSI with a 6-gallon tank is sufficient for intermittent cuts. For 60A models (PrimeWeld, ARCCAPTAIN, YESWELDER), aim for 4.5–5 CFM at 65–75 PSI with an 8-gallon or larger tank to handle sustained cutting without pressure drops. Always add an inline moisture trap and filter — water in the air line is the fastest way to destroy consumables.

Common Mistakes to Avoid

  • Skipping the moisture trap. Water in your compressed air kills consumables fast and degrades cut quality. Always use an inline filter and moisture separator.
  • Running too much or too little air pressure. Check the manufacturer’s recommended PSI for your amperage setting. Wrong pressure causes a wide, sloppy arc or blows out the pilot.
  • Ignoring consumable wear. A worn nozzle or electrode does not just cut poorly; it can damage the torch head. Swap them at the first sign of degraded cuts.
  • Buying without checking consumable availability. Some torches use proprietary parts that are harder to find. Confirm parts are in stock and reasonably priced before you buy.
  • Choosing HF start for a CNC table. High-frequency arc starts interfere with computers and CNC controllers. If you plan to add a cutting table, get a blowback or non-HF unit.
  • Undersizing your compressor. A compressor that cannot keep up with your cutter’s CFM demand leads to pressure drops, inconsistent cuts, and faster consumable wear. Match your compressor to the cutter’s requirements before you buy.
